According to 绿帽社 internal database and industry insights, the Global Shipbuilding Market was valued at USD 155 Bill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 192 Billion by 2031, growing at a compound annual growth rate of 5.90% during the forecast period (2025-2031).
The Global Shipbuilding Market is a dynamic and competitive industry driven by factors such as increasing international trade, the demand for energy resources, and the growth of the global economy. The market encompasses the construction of various types of vessels, including cargo ships, container ships, oil tankers, and cruise ships. Key players in the industry include major shipbuilding companies from countries such as South Korea, China, and Japan, which dominate the market with their technological expertise and economies of scale. However, emerging markets like Vietnam and Brazil are also making significant strides in shipbuilding. The market is influenced by regulations, environmental concerns, and technological advancements, with a growing emphasis on sustainability and digitalization shaping the future of the industry.
The Global Shipbuilding Market is experiencing a shift towards eco-friendly and sustainable practices, driven by regulatory requirements and increasing environmental awareness. There is a growing demand for vessels with lower emissions and improved fuel efficiency, leading to opportunities in the development of innovative technologies such as LNG-powered ships and electric propulsion systems. Additionally, digitalization and automation are transforming the industry, with a focus on enhancing efficiency and reducing operational costs. The rise of offshore wind energy projects and the expansion of the cruise industry present further growth prospects for the shipbuilding market. Collaboration with technology providers and investment in research and development are crucial for shipbuilders to stay competitive and capitalize on these emerging trends and opportunities.
The Global Shipbuilding Market faces several challenges, including overcapacity leading to intense competition among shipbuilders, fluctuating demand for new vessels due to economic uncertainties, and increasing regulatory requirements for environmental sustainability. Additionally, the industry is highly capital-intensive, making it vulnerable to economic downturns and financial instability. Geopolitical tensions and trade disputes can also impact the market by disrupting supply chains and affecting global trade patterns. Furthermore, rapid technological advancements and the shift towards digitalization require shipbuilders to invest in innovation and upskilling their workforce to remain competitive. Overall, navigating these challenges requires strategic planning, adaptability, and a focus on sustainable practices in the Global Shipbuilding Market.

Government policies related to the Global Shipbuilding Market vary by country, but common themes include providing subsidies and financial support to domestic shipbuilders to remain competitive in the global market, implementing regulations to ensure environmental sustainability and safety standards, and promoting innovation and technology development in the industry. For example, countries like South Korea and China have implemented extensive financial support programs for their shipbuilding industries, while the European Union has focused on promoting sustainable practices and reducing emissions from ships. Additionally, governments often play a role in trade agreements and negotiations to support their domestic shipbuilding industries and ensure fair competition. Overall, government policies in the Global Shipbuilding Market aim to support and grow the industry while addressing challenges such as overcapacity and market fluctuations.

In the Global Shipbuilding Market, Asia dominates with countries like South Korea, China, and Japan leading the industry due to their advanced technology, infrastructure, and skilled workforce. North America follows closely behind, particularly with the United States playing a significant role in naval and commercial shipbuilding. Europe boasts a strong presence in shipbuilding, with countries like Germany, Italy, and the Netherlands known for their high-quality vessels. The Middle East and Africa region is witnessing growth in shipbuilding activities, particularly in countries like UAE and South Africa. Latin America, on the other hand, is seeing a steady increase in shipbuilding projects, with Brazil being a key player in the region. Overall, Asia remains the powerhouse in the Global Shipbuilding Market, with other regions also making notable contributions to the industry.
